As of Oct 19, 2023 the project was awarded to Top line construction for $281,612.56 . The Project consists of the removal and replacement of ADA ramps, driveway apron repairs, drainage improvements, select curb replacement, milling of the road surface, roadway pavement repairs, areas of roadway reconstruction, the installation of 2" of HMA surface course, and the installation of traffic striping and markings, as well as site restoration. All work on this contract must be completed within 30 calendar days from issuance of a Notice to Proceed. Contract documents and drawings for the proposed work (the "Contract Documents", which have been prepared by William H Burr, IV, P.E.,, of the firm Colliers Engineering & Design Inc. (DBA Maser Consulting), will be on file at the below date in the Borough of Hampton, 1 Wells Ave, Hampton, NJ 08827. Proposals must be made on the standard proposal forms included with the Contract Documents in the manner designated in the Contract Documents, must be enclosed in sealed envelopes bearing the name and address of the bidder and the name of the project on the outside and be addressed to the Borough of Hampton, and must be accompanied by a statement of consent of surety from a surety company authorized to do business in the State of New Jersey and acceptable to the Owner and either a bid bond or a certified check drawn to the order of Borough of Hampton for not less than ten percent (10%) of the amount bid, except that the check shall not exceed $20,000.00. The award of the Contract for this project will not be made until the necessary funds have been provided by the Owner in a lawful manner. Proposals for this contract will only be accepted from bidders who have properly qualified in accordance with the requirements of the Contract Documents. The right is also reserved to reject any or all bids or to waive any informalities where such informality is not detrimental to the best interest of the Owner, except as to those items which are deemed mandatory and non-waivable set forth in N.J.S.A. 40A:11-23.2. Further, the Owner reserves the right to abandon the project and reject the bids entirely if any legal or state or federal administrative action is taken against the Owner which could delay or jeopardize the project from commencing. The right is also reserved to increase or decrease the quantities specified in the manner designated in the Specifications. The successful bidder shall be required to comply with all applicable statutory and regulatory requirements, which include but are not limited to the affirmative action requirements of P.L. 1975, c. 127, N.J.S.A. 10:5-31 et seq. and N.J.A.C. 17:27-1 et seq. Bidders will be required to comply with the public disclosure provisions of N.J.S.A. 52:25-24.2.
